Research
The Pradhan-Sundd lab’s research focuses on chronic organ injury and the processes of hepatic hemoglobin, heme and iron clearance in sickle cell disease.

Tirthadipa Pradhan-Sundd Laboratory
Tirthadipa “Dipa” Pradhan-Sundd’s laboratory at Versiti Blood Research Institute studies hepato-vascular cells in sickle cell disease and other hematological disorders.
